Filter Products

Departments

devacurl

67 results

$21.41
$28.31 discounted from $32.55
$29.30 discounted from $33.69
$29.30 discounted from $33.69
$29.30 discounted from $33.69
$22.64 discounted from $26.03
$13.38 discounted from $18.91
$29.30 discounted from $33.69
$41.78 discounted from $50.13
$52.09 discounted from $57.44
$31.23 discounted from $37.47
$39.29 discounted from $47.14